PROBLEM TO BE SOLVED: To provide a technique for printing on a sheet such as a film by using a concrete surface setting retarder as an ink base stock, which is related to the technique for forming decorative concrete using the concrete surface setting retarder and which is suitable for forming the decorative concrete by improving such a weak point that the majority of the conventional concrete surface setting retarders are soluble in water and have so weak adhesive power as to be inevitably modified and used for printing and fine edging is hardly performed, when a figure or a picture pattern such as a photograph is printed on the sheet such as the film by using the concrete surface setting retarder as the ink base stock and the printed sheet is stuck to a molding flask.;SOLUTION: The concrete surface setting retarder which is insoluble in water and soluble in alkali and has both of firm adhesive power and drying property as an ink, is applied and screen printing is adopted as a printing method, so that a coating film having the thickness, fineness and suitability for forming the decorative concrete, which are characteristics of the printing method, can be printed.;COPYRIGHT: (C)2012,JPO&INPIT
